Free Agent wide receivers:

A.J. Green
The biggest red flag about A.J.Green is that he’s 31, going to be 32 by the time the 2020 season starts. Green is coming off a injury riddled 2019 season. Although there were multiple reports of him possible starting the year and returning mid year, Green did not play a single snap.
With all that said, Green could be in line for a huge contract if the Bengals decide not to franchise tag him or opt to let him go. Teams like Green Bay and New England should compete for his services if he is allowed to walk. The New Orleans Saints offense would be lethal with an addition like A.J. Green.
Green’s last healthy season was in 2017 with an stat line of 75 receptions 1078 yards and 8 touchdowns.

More Realistic Options

Phillip Dorsett
Things may have not turned out the way Phillip Dorsett expected too with being the former 2016 first round draft pick, however ending up in New England may have been the best thing for him with almost 400 yards receiving 5 touchdowns and averaging 13.7 yards he also became one of Brady’s more reliable targets and kinda rejuvenated his career with the Pats and should be on the Saints top list and he is my personal #1 choice of all the free agents

Demarcus Robinson
Out of all the free agents I believe Robinson is the most intriguing I really do like what he possess as a receiver and at times he looked good playing under Andy Reid and Pat Mahomes averaging 14 yards a catch, I think he could come to New Orleans on a cheap deal and immediately play well in Payton’s offense.

Tajae Sharpe
Tajae Sharpe is what you would call a case of too many wide receivers in one room ordeal, in Tennessee a room with Corey Davis, Adam Humpries, and rookie standout AJ Brown Sharpe fell down the depth chart and lost snaps yet still had 4 touchdowns and a lot of teams would have loved to have a player like Sharpe be their 4th receiver he could easily replace Ted Ginn in this offense can take the top off defenses.
